Opus People Solutions are recruiting on behalf of North Northamptonshire Council for a dedicated and organised Business Support Assistant to join the Shared Lives North team. This is an excellent opportunity for an experienced administrator who enjoys delivering high-quality support, maintaining accurate records, and providing outstanding customer service. Working within a supportive team, you will play a key role in ensuring the smooth day-to-day operation of the service through the provision of efficient and confidential administrative support.

As a Business Support Assistant, you will support managers and colleagues by maintaining records and systems, handling enquiries, coordinating office resources, and ensuring information is managed accurately and securely. In this role, your duties will include:

  • Providing confidential administrative support to managers and the wider team.
  • Maintaining accurate electronic and paper-based records and information systems.
  • Producing documents, reports, correspondence and other administrative materials to a high standard.
  • Managing and updating customer, staff and performance-related information.
  • Supporting financial processes, including maintaining accurate records and following established procedures.
  • Ordering office supplies and resources to support the effective operation of the service.
  • Managing diaries, arranging meetings and supporting scheduling requirements.
  • Responding to telephone, email and face-to-face enquiries in a professional and courteous manner.
  • Providing reception support and acting as a first point of contact for visitors and callers.
  • Building positive working relationships with colleagues, customers, carers and external partners.
  • Ensuring compliance with data protection, confidentiality and relevant Council policies and procedures.
